Resolución de errores de parámetros del servidor cuando se realizan sesiones de importación de archivos
This article applies to
This article does not apply to
This article is not tied to any specific product.
Not all product versions are identified in this article.
Symptoms
Durante las operaciones de importación de archivos entre VNX1/VNX2 y sistemas Unity, algunos valores de parámetros se deben mantener dentro de ciertos límites para garantizar operaciones de importación de archivos correctas y no disruptivas. En el siguiente ejemplo, se muestra un parámetro que se configura de manera diferente en el lado de VNX que en el lado de Unity y, en esta situación, se produce un error en la sesión de creación de importación de archivos:
Crear sesión de importación de VDM.......................... x Fallido
Detalles
Fallido: Error de parámetro del servidor: {0}Busque kb000490660 en la base de conocimientos de EMC en https://support.emc.com. (Código de error: 0x9000195)
Cause
En este artículo de la base de conocimientos, se describen los valores de parámetros del servidor que se comprueban durante la creación de la sesión de importación de archivos y se explica cómo resolver problemas de incompatibilidad. El motivo para mantener un rango aceptable de valores de parámetros entre los sistemas VNX y Unity es garantizar que el acceso de host no se interrumpa durante el proceso de importación/migración de archivos. Si se cambian los valores de los parámetros fuera de las recomendaciones que se describen a continuación, no se puede garantizar la transparencia de la migración a los usuarios del host.
Resolution
La siguiente lista contiene los parámetros que se comprueban durante las operaciones de importación de archivos entre VNX y Unity.
nfs.transChecksum
Descripción:
especifica si el administrador de transferencia de datos admite Oracle Direct NFS (DNFS) para los clientes que utilizan Oracle Database 11g con NFSv3. Cuando se habilita la compatibilidad, el administrador de transferencia de datos garantiza que cada transacción lleve un ID único y evita la posibilidad de ID conflictivos que resultan de la reutilización de puertos cedidos.
0 = No admite DNFS.
1 = Compatibilidad con clientes DNFS de Oracle 11g que utilizan NFSv3.
Rango de valores: Valor predeterminado de 0 o 1
VNX1/2:
0 Valor predeterminado de Unity:
0 Regla de comprobación previa de migración de archivos: Valor act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: Cuando el valor de VNX1/2 se configura en 1 y el valor de Unity es 0, las aplicaciones de Oracle podrían provocar daños en los datos después de la transferencia de la migración, en caso de conmutación por error del clúster de Oracle. Una I/O después de la conmutación por error del clúster podría considerarse como realizada cuando no era el caso.
nfs.v3xfersize
Descripción: Especifica el tamaño de transferencia predeterminado para lecturas y escrituras de NFSv3.
Rango de valores: de 8192 a 1048576
El valor predeterminado de VNX1/2 se basa en el tamaño de la memoria del módulo
DM 6G: 65536
8G/12G/16G:
131072 24G:
262144 Valor predeterminado de Unity:
Unity300: 65536
Unity400:
131072 Unity500:
131072 Unity600:
262144 Regla de comprobación previa de la migración de archivos: Valor <act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: Puede causar un error de I/O en el cliente después de la transferencia de la migración, que no se resolverá hasta que el usuario vuelva a montar, cuyo valor en el origen VNX1/2 es mayor que el del arreglo Unity de destino.
filesystem.rstchown
Descripción:
establece la propiedad restringida de los archivos.
0 = Permite que el propietario de un archivo cambie la propiedad del archivo o el ID de grupo a cualquier otro propietario o grupo, ya que chown y chgrp siguen la semántica menos restrictiva de la interfaz del sistema operativo portátil para Unix (POSIX).
1 = permitir que solo el superusuario cambie el propietario de un archivo. El propietario actual puede cambiar el ID de grupo solo a un grupo al que pertenezca el propietario. Nota: Este parámetro se aplica a NFS, pero no a CIFS.
Rango de valores: Valor predeterminado de 0 o 1
VNX1/2:
1 Valor predeterminado de Unity:
1 Regla de comprobación previa de migración de archivos: Valor act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: En caso de que el VNX1/2 de origen obtenga un valor de 0 y Unity de destino tenga 1 como valor, la aplicación que se ejecuta con ID y no con raíz podría obtener un error cuando solía poder cambiar la propiedad de usuario/grupo del archivo que creó.
quota.useQuotasInFsStat
Descripción:
controla si se incluyen cuotas cuando se muestran las estadísticas de espacio libre del sistema de archivos a los clientes de NFS que utilizan el comando df -k de UNIX para ver las estadísticas.
0 = excluir cuotas cuando se realiza una verificación de cuota de disco mediante df. El espacio disponible real puede ser menor que el "espacio disponible" que se muestra en la salida del comando.
1 = Incluir cuotas. El comando df ejecutado por un usuario que no es raíz informa solo el espacio disponible para el usuario. Esto significa que el "espacio disponible" muestra los factores en el espacio que se asignaron previamente a los grupos y los árboles de cuotas. rquota no es compatible con las cuotas de árbol.
Rango de valores: Valor predeterminado de 0 o 1
VNX1/2:
0 Valor predeterminado de Unity:
0 Regla de comprobación previa de migración de archivos: Valor act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: Cuando un usuario de NFS observa el espacio disponible en las exportaciones a las que tiene acceso (a través del comando df), verá el tamaño completo del sistema de archivos, que es mayor que la cantidad de espacio que puede utilizar debido a su límite de cuota de usuario, si el valor de este parámetro en VNX1/2 es 1 y en Unity es 0.
cvfs.virtualDirName
Descripción:
VVFS versión 2 permite a los usuarios atravesar el punto de control montado desde un directorio virtual oculto. Este parámetro define un nombre de directorio virtual especificado por el usuario. El nombre de directorio real es la cadena especificada precedida por un punto.
Ejemplo:
ckpt = Utilice .ckpt para el nombre del directorio virtual.
snapshot = utilice .snapshot como el nombre del directorio virtual.
Nota: Reinicie el administrador de transferencia de datos para que los cambios surtan efecto.
Rango de valores: *
Valor predeterminado de VNX1/2: ckpt
Valor predeterminado de Unity: ckpt
Regla de comprobación previa de la migración de archivos: Valor actual de VNX1/2= valor actual de Unity = punto de referencia
Impacto en la migración de archivos Si omitimos esta comprobación: La función de migración de archivos no migra las instantáneas de un sistema de archivos. Internamente, el .ckpt se trata como el nombre de directorio virtual predeterminado y se ignora durante la copia de datos. El uso de un valor diferente en VNX1/2 podría provocar dos problemas:
Los datos reales del directorio virtual se migran al arreglo de destino, a pesar de que son inútiles y permiten perder tiempo.
Si .ckpt se utiliza para otro propósito, los datos en ese directorio se perderán en el destino después de la transferencia de la migración.
Resolución de problemas de parámetros:
Puede resolver las diferencias de parámetros a través de cualquiera de las siguientes tres opciones:
2. Si prefiere modificar los parámetros en el sistema Unity de destino, utilice la herramienta de servicio svc_param para modificar el valor del parámetro correspondiente. Utilice svc_param -help para ver el uso de este script.
3. Utilice la opción -skipServerParamCheck durante la creación de la sesión de importación para omitir la comprobación de parámetros si se utiliza UEMCLI o desmarque la casilla de verificación "Permitir la comparación de parámetros del servidor" en el asistente de creación de sesiones de importación de la GUI, en la página "Settings".
Nota: Omitir la comprobación de parámetros podría provocar la interrupción del host cuando las sesiones de importación de archivos se transfieran al sistema Unity y, en algunos casos, puede requerir que los hosts NFS vuelvan a montar los sistemas de archivos. La comprobación de parámetros está diseñada para garantizar que se obtenga "transparencia de NFS" (ausencia de interrupciones para los clientes) con las operaciones de importación de archivos.
nfs.transChecksum
Descripción:
especifica si el administrador de transferencia de datos admite Oracle Direct NFS (DNFS) para los clientes que utilizan Oracle Database 11g con NFSv3. Cuando se habilita la compatibilidad, el administrador de transferencia de datos garantiza que cada transacción lleve un ID único y evita la posibilidad de ID conflictivos que resultan de la reutilización de puertos cedidos.
0 = No admite DNFS.
1 = Compatibilidad con clientes DNFS de Oracle 11g que utilizan NFSv3.
Rango de valores: Valor predeterminado de 0 o 1
VNX1/2:
0 Valor predeterminado de Unity:
0 Regla de comprobación previa de migración de archivos: Valor act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: Cuando el valor de VNX1/2 se configura en 1 y el valor de Unity es 0, las aplicaciones de Oracle podrían provocar daños en los datos después de la transferencia de la migración, en caso de conmutación por error del clúster de Oracle. Una I/O después de la conmutación por error del clúster podría considerarse como realizada cuando no era el caso.
nfs.v3xfersize
Descripción: Especifica el tamaño de transferencia predeterminado para lecturas y escrituras de NFSv3.
Rango de valores: de 8192 a 1048576
El valor predeterminado de VNX1/2 se basa en el tamaño de la memoria del módulo
DM 6G: 65536
8G/12G/16G:
131072 24G:
262144 Valor predeterminado de Unity:
Unity300: 65536
Unity400:
131072 Unity500:
131072 Unity600:
262144 Regla de comprobación previa de la migración de archivos: Valor <act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: Puede causar un error de I/O en el cliente después de la transferencia de la migración, que no se resolverá hasta que el usuario vuelva a montar, cuyo valor en el origen VNX1/2 es mayor que el del arreglo Unity de destino.
filesystem.rstchown
Descripción:
establece la propiedad restringida de los archivos.
0 = Permite que el propietario de un archivo cambie la propiedad del archivo o el ID de grupo a cualquier otro propietario o grupo, ya que chown y chgrp siguen la semántica menos restrictiva de la interfaz del sistema operativo portátil para Unix (POSIX).
1 = permitir que solo el superusuario cambie el propietario de un archivo. El propietario actual puede cambiar el ID de grupo solo a un grupo al que pertenezca el propietario. Nota: Este parámetro se aplica a NFS, pero no a CIFS.
Rango de valores: Valor predeterminado de 0 o 1
VNX1/2:
1 Valor predeterminado de Unity:
1 Regla de comprobación previa de migración de archivos: Valor act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: En caso de que el VNX1/2 de origen obtenga un valor de 0 y Unity de destino tenga 1 como valor, la aplicación que se ejecuta con ID y no con raíz podría obtener un error cuando solía poder cambiar la propiedad de usuario/grupo del archivo que creó.
quota.useQuotasInFsStat
Descripción:
controla si se incluyen cuotas cuando se muestran las estadísticas de espacio libre del sistema de archivos a los clientes de NFS que utilizan el comando df -k de UNIX para ver las estadísticas.
0 = excluir cuotas cuando se realiza una verificación de cuota de disco mediante df. El espacio disponible real puede ser menor que el "espacio disponible" que se muestra en la salida del comando.
1 = Incluir cuotas. El comando df ejecutado por un usuario que no es raíz informa solo el espacio disponible para el usuario. Esto significa que el "espacio disponible" muestra los factores en el espacio que se asignaron previamente a los grupos y los árboles de cuotas. rquota no es compatible con las cuotas de árbol.
Rango de valores: Valor predeterminado de 0 o 1
VNX1/2:
0 Valor predeterminado de Unity:
0 Regla de comprobación previa de migración de archivos: Valor actual de VNX1/2 = valor
actual de Unity Impacto en la migración de archivos Si omitimos esta comprobación: Cuando un usuario de NFS observa el espacio disponible en las exportaciones a las que tiene acceso (a través del comando df), verá el tamaño completo del sistema de archivos, que es mayor que la cantidad de espacio que puede utilizar debido a su límite de cuota de usuario, si el valor de este parámetro en VNX1/2 es 1 y en Unity es 0.
cvfs.virtualDirName
Descripción:
VVFS versión 2 permite a los usuarios atravesar el punto de control montado desde un directorio virtual oculto. Este parámetro define un nombre de directorio virtual especificado por el usuario. El nombre de directorio real es la cadena especificada precedida por un punto.
Ejemplo:
ckpt = Utilice .ckpt para el nombre del directorio virtual.
snapshot = utilice .snapshot como el nombre del directorio virtual.
Nota: Reinicie el administrador de transferencia de datos para que los cambios surtan efecto.
Rango de valores: *
Valor predeterminado de VNX1/2: ckpt
Valor predeterminado de Unity: ckpt
Regla de comprobación previa de la migración de archivos: Valor actual de VNX1/2= valor actual de Unity = punto de referencia
Impacto en la migración de archivos Si omitimos esta comprobación: La función de migración de archivos no migra las instantáneas de un sistema de archivos. Internamente, el .ckpt se trata como el nombre de directorio virtual predeterminado y se ignora durante la copia de datos. El uso de un valor diferente en VNX1/2 podría provocar dos problemas:
Los datos reales del directorio virtual se migran al arreglo de destino, a pesar de que son inútiles y permiten perder tiempo.
Si .ckpt se utiliza para otro propósito, los datos en ese directorio se perderán en el destino después de la transferencia de la migración.
Resolución de problemas de parámetros:
Puede resolver las diferencias de parámetros a través de cualquiera de las siguientes tres opciones:
- Modifique el parámetro de VNX de origen a un rango aceptable para la operación de importación de Unity (server_param)
- Modifique el parámetro Target Unity para que coincida con los valores ubicados en el administrador de transferencia de datos de VNX (VDM) [svc_param]
- Para omitir las comprobaciones de parámetros al crear la sesión de importación de archivos en la GUI, desactive la casilla de verificación "Permitir la comparación de parámetros del servidor" o utilice "-skipServerParamCheck" si se crea una sesión de importación desde UEMCLI
2. Si prefiere modificar los parámetros en el sistema Unity de destino, utilice la herramienta de servicio svc_param para modificar el valor del parámetro correspondiente. Utilice svc_param -help para ver el uso de este script.
3. Utilice la opción -skipServerParamCheck durante la creación de la sesión de importación para omitir la comprobación de parámetros si se utiliza UEMCLI o desmarque la casilla de verificación "Permitir la comparación de parámetros del servidor" en el asistente de creación de sesiones de importación de la GUI, en la página "Settings".
Nota: Omitir la comprobación de parámetros podría provocar la interrupción del host cuando las sesiones de importación de archivos se transfieran al sistema Unity y, en algunos casos, puede requerir que los hosts NFS vuelvan a montar los sistemas de archivos. La comprobación de parámetros está diseñada para garantizar que se obtenga "transparencia de NFS" (ausencia de interrupciones para los clientes) con las operaciones de importación de archivos.
Affected Products
Dell EMC Unity FamilyProducts
Dell Unity 300, Dell EMC Unity 300F, Dell EMC Unity 400, Dell EMC Unity 400F, Dell EMC Unity 500, Dell EMC Unity 500F, Dell EMC Unity 600, Dell EMC Unity 600F, Dell EMC Unity Family |Dell EMC Unity All Flash, Dell EMC Unity Family
, Dell EMC Unity Hybrid
...
Article Properties
Article Number: 000054849
Article Type: Solution
Last Modified: 11 Dec 2025
Version: 4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.